Transaction 70434e5941146b3d218f5a6e12b523370454ab601c82c66b6df3fa2ad8c1d945
1 Input
1 Output
-
70434e5941146b3d218f5a6e12b523370454ab601c82c66b6df3fa2ad8c1d945:0
- value
- 313957
- script pubkey
- OP_0 OP_PUSHBYTES_20 34e5ec0674cb56bb1027ad75baaa7f53b4e34748
- address
- bc1qxnj7cpn5edttkyp8446m42nl2w6wx36g8pvlr9